FRIED BANANA SPLIT
Provided by Giada De Laurentiis
Categories dessert
Time 20m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- For the chocolate sauce: Combine the chocolate and 1/4 cup water in a heavy small saucepan. Stir over medium-low heat until the sauce is melted and smooth. Remove from the heat. Stir in small pinch cayenne pepper. Set aside.
- For the bananas: Place the brown sugar in a pie dish or on a plate. Toss the bananas in the brown sugar until nicely coated. Melt the butter in a heavy large skillet over medium-high heat until the butter becomes golden brown. Add the bananas to the hot pan cut-side down. Turn the bananas over as soon as they are golden brown and the sugar forms a crunchy coat on the bananas, about 30 seconds per side (do not allow bananas to become soft and mushy). Divide the bananas between 2 shallow bowls or plates. Spoon the chocolate sauce over the bananas. Sprinkle with the toasted almonds, and serve immediately.
- Cook's Notes: To toast the almonds, arrange them in a single layer on a baking sheet. Bake in a preheated 350 degrees F oven for 6 to 8 minutes until lightly toasted. Cool completely before using.
- An alternate way to melt the chocolate is to combine the chocolate and water in a small metal bowl over a small saucepan of simmering water, and stir the chocolate mixture until melted and smooth. Remove the bowl from over the water and set aside.
THE ULTIMATE BANANA SPLIT
Steps:
- Preheat your oil in a heavy-based pot for deep frying to 365 degrees F.
- In a large mixing bowl combine flour, cornstarch, baking powder, sugar, salt, and cinnamon. Make a well in the center and add the yolks and club soda. Using a whisk, stir from the inside working your way out, slowly incorporating the dry ingredients without forming any lumps. Peel the bananas and dip in the batter and coat well. Fry in hot oil for 4-5 minutes until batter is puffy and golden brown. Drain on paper towels when done.
- While bananas are cooking, prepare caramel sauce. Combine the sugar and water in a large heavy saucepan over medium heat. Cook, swirling the pot around, until the mixture is a deep caramel color and looks like syrup, about 8 minutes. Add the butter then carefully pour in the cream (it will bubble up) and continue to cook for another minute. Add a pinch of salt then cool before serving.
- To serve the banana split, cut the bananas lengthwise and top with a large scoop of vanilla bean ice cream. Pour warm caramel sauce over the top and finish with a sprinkle of banana chips and toasted pecans.

BANANA SPLIT STIR-FRY
Interesting and yummy sounding recipe I derived from the local newspaper. Could be a delicious and decadent recipe to serve to dinner guests you want to impress!
Provided by Boyz 5
Categories Dessert
Time 30m
Yield 4 , 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Prepare fruits for raw fruit plate and arrange on individual serving plates to be set aside.
- In large non-stick fry pan on medium heat, melt butter. Add cinnamon, maple syrup and vanilla.
- Add bananas and brown lightly on each side. Add pecans, sizzle in mangoes and kiwis. Immediately add coconut milk and then turn stove off.
- Spoon over the prepared, plated raw fruit, add a scoop of frozen yogurt or vanilla ice-cream and enjoy!

BANANA SPLIT BREAD
Make and share this Banana Split Bread recipe from Food.com.
Provided by Bluenoser
Categories Quick Breads
Time 1h15m
Yield 1 loaf
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- In a bowl cream butter and sugar.
- Beat in egg.
- In a second bowl combine milk and mashed bananas.
- Combine flour, baking soda and baking powder.
- Add to cream mixture alternately with banana mixture.
- Fold in pecans and chocolate chips.
- Pour into greased loaf pan
- Bake 350°F 60 to 70 minutes.
- Cool 10 minutes before removing from pan.
- Complete cooling on wire rack.

BANANA SPLIT TRIFLE
A yummy sounding dessert, which I have not tried yet. Will wait for warmer weather. I got it from a military commissary calendar
Provided by SweetSueAl
Categories Dessert
Time 1h45m
Yield 10 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Whisk mild and pudding for 2 minutes in a large bowl. Stir in pineapple.
- Place half of the angel food cake in a large glass bowl, preferrably a trifle bowl.
- Spread 1/3 of the pudding mixture on top.
- Cover with strawberriesHeat fudge topping according to microwave directions on the jar, just until pourable.
- Pour half of the topping over previous layer.
- Layer remaining cake cubes on top of the hot fudge layer.
- Spread another 1/3 of the pudding mixture, top with sliced bananas; cover with remaining 1/3 of pudding mixture.
- Spread whipped topping over all.
- Drizzle with hot fudge topping and sprinkle with pecans.
- Chill until serving. Garnish with strawberries and bananas just before serving.

BANANA FLOWER STIR FRY - A VEGETARAN RECIPE BY SAVORY SPIN
From savoryspin.com
4.3/5 (15)Total Time 40 minsCategory Side DishesCalories 72 per serving
- Clean the banana flower by rinsing under cold water. Remove the outer "bracts" purple leaves and set them aside in a bowl of cold water with lemon.
- Pull out a "blossom" tucked inside and remove the "pistil" (the more brittle stick with a head on it) and the "scale" (the small, translucent part) and discard these. Place the blossom without the pistil and scale in the bowl of cold water with lemon, with the bracts.
- When all the blossoms have been cleaned, you will have the heart of the banana flower. Rinse it and chop and place in the same bowl along with blossoms and bracts.
- Chop onion, ginger, and garlic and add all three to a saucepan with olive oil. Turn on the stove to medium heat and saute onions, ginger, and garlic for about 10 minutes, stirring often.
